Conjecture on the Stanley depth of cyclic graph edge ideals

Let S=K[x1,,xn]S=K[x_1,\ldots,x_n] be a polynomial ring, and let JnJ_n denote the ideal associated with the cyclic graph on nn vertices as in the paper. The Stanley depth conjecture. For all n10n\geq 10 satisfying n1(mod3)n\equiv 1\pmod{3},

sdepth(S/Jn)=n3.\operatorname{sdepth}(S/J_n)=\left\lceil\frac{n}{3}\right\rceil.

This conjecture concerns the remaining congruence class in the authors' study of the Stanley depth of quotients by ideals associated with line and cyclic graphs; the stated examples support the formula, but the claim is not resolved in the supplied source.
